A 1.00 m3 container of air absorbs 6098 J of heat at a constant pressure of 1.00 atm. Air has a density of 1.20 kg/m3, a constant-pressure specific heat of 1010 J/(kg·°C), and a thermal coefficient of expansion of 3.67 10-3 (°C)-1.

(a) Find the increase in the temperature of the air.

°C

(b) Find the work done by the air.

(c) Find the increase in the air's internal energy.
